Diferència entre el programari del sistema i el programari d'aplicació

Autora: Laura McKinney
Data De La Creació: 1 Abril 2021
Data D’Actualització: 12 Ser Possible 2024
Anonim
Diferència entre el programari del sistema i el programari d'aplicació - Tecnologia
Diferència entre el programari del sistema i el programari d'aplicació - Tecnologia

Content


El programari es classifica bàsicament en dues categories, Programari de sistema i Programari d'aplicació. Quan el programari del sistema actua com a interfície entre el programari d’aplicació i el maquinari de l’ordinador. El programari d'aplicació actua una interfície entre l'usuari i el programari del sistema. Podem distingir el programari de sistema i el programari d'aplicacions a causa de l'objectiu del seu disseny. El Programari del sistema està dissenyat per gestionar els recursos del sistema i també proporciona una plataforma per executar programari d'aplicacions. Per altra banda Programari d'aplicació estan dissenyats perquè els usuaris puguin realitzar les seves tasques específiques.

Explorem algunes diferències més entre el programari de sistema i el programari d'aplicacions amb l'ajut del gràfic de comparació que es mostra a continuació.


Contingut: Programari d'aplicació Vs Software Software System

  1. Gràfic de comparació
  2. Definició
  3. Diferències claus
  4. Conclusió

Gràfic de comparació

Bases per a la comparacióProgramari del sistemaProgramari d'aplicació
BàsicEl programari del sistema gestiona els recursos del sistema i proporciona una plataforma perquè el programari d’aplicacions s’executi. El programari d'aplicació, quan s'executa, realitza tasques específiques, estan dissenyats per a.
LlenguatgeEl programari del sistema està escrit en un llenguatge de baix nivell, és a dir, en un llenguatge de muntatge.El programari d’aplicacions està escrit en un llenguatge d’alt nivell com Java, C ++, .net, VB, etc.
CorrerEl programari del sistema comença a funcionar quan el sistema està engegat i s’executa fins que el sistema s’apaga.El programari d'aplicació s'executa com i quan l'usuari ho sol·licita.
RequerimentUn sistema no pot executar-se sense programari del sistema.Ni tan sols és necessari que es faci un programa d’aplicació per executar el sistema; és específic per a l'usuari.
PropòsitEl programari del sistema és d’ús general. El programari d'aplicació té un propòsit específic.
ExemplesSistema operatiu.Microsoft Office, Photoshop, programari d'animació, etc.


Definició del programari de sistema

El programari de sistema és el programari que està escrit en un llenguatge de baix nivell, com a llenguatge de muntatge. El propòsit principal del programari de sistema és fer-ho gestionar i controlar els recursos del sistema. S'ocupa de la gestió de la memòria, la gestió de processos, la protecció i la seguretat del sistema. També proporciona l’entorn informàtic a altres programes com el programari d’aplicació.

El programari del sistema crea una interfície entre el maquinari del sistema i l’usuari. Fa entendre els sistemes, l'ordre introduït per l'usuari. També actua com a interfície entre el programari d’aplicació i el maquinari. El programari del sistema comença a funcionar quan el sistema està encès i gestiona tots els recursos del sistema i s’executa fins que el sistema s’apaga.

El programari del sistema és programari de propòsit general i és essencial per al funcionament de l’ordinador. Generalment, l’usuari final no interactua directament amb el programari del sistema. L’usuari interactua amb la GUI creada pel programari del sistema. El millor exemple per al programari del sistema és el sistema operatiu.

Definició de programari d'aplicació

Application Software és un programari escrit a llenguatge d’alt nivell com Java, VB, .net, etc. El programari d'aplicació és específic per a l'usuari i està dissenyat per satisfer els requisits de l'usuari. Pot ser un programari informàtic, programari d'edició, disseny de programari, etc. Això significa que cada programari d'aplicació està dissenyat per a finalitat específica.

El programari d'aplicació s'executa a la plataforma creada pel programari del sistema. El programari d'aplicació és un intermediari entre l'usuari final i el programari de sistema. Podeu instal·lar diversos programes d'aplicació en un programari del sistema. El programari d'aplicació no és fonamental per executar un sistema, però fa que el sistema sigui útil. Els exemples de programari d’aplicacions són MS Office, Photoshop, etc.

Diferències claus entre el programari del sistema i el programari d’aplicació

  1. El programari del sistema està dissenyat per gestionar els recursos del sistema com la gestió de la memòria, la gestió de processos, la protecció i la seguretat, etc., i també proporciona la plataforma perquè el programari de l'aplicació s'executi. D'altra banda, el Programari d'aplicació està dissenyat per satisfer els requisits dels usuaris per realitzar tasques específiques.
  2. El programari del sistema està escrit en un llenguatge de baix nivell com el llenguatge de muntatge. Tot i això, el programari d’aplicacions està escrit en un llenguatge d’alt nivell com Java, C ++, .net, VB, etc.
  3. El programari del sistema comença a funcionar a mesura que el sistema s’encén i s’executa fins que el sistema s’apaga. El programari d’aplicació s’inicia quan l’usuari l’inicia i s’atura quan l’atura.
  4. Un sistema no pot funcionar sense el programari del sistema, mentre que, el programari d'aplicació és específic per a l'usuari, no han d'estar executats per un sistema; estan destinats només als usuaris.
  5. Quan el programari del sistema és un programari d’ús general, el programari d’aplicació és un programari d’ús específic.
  6. El millor exemple de programari de sistema és el sistema operatiu, mentre que, els exemples de programari d'aplicació són MicroSoft Office, Photoshop, etc.

Conclusió:

Tots dos, el Programari del sistema i el Programari d'aplicació fan que un sistema sigui útil per a l'usuari final. El programari del sistema és obligatori perquè el sistema funcioni. De la mateixa manera, el programari d'aplicació és necessari perquè l'usuari realitzi la seva tasca específica.